Emilie Rose LANG 1840–1918 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 29 JAN 1840

Birth Location: Sierentz, 68, Haut-Rhin

Death Date: 07 DEC 1918

Death Location: Paris, 75008

Father: Isaac LANG

Mother: Rosette ARON

Spouse(s): Léopold LOUIS-DREYFUS

Children(s): Charles LOUIS-DREYFUS

The story of Emilie Rose LANG began in 1840 in Sierentz, 68, Haut-Rhin. Emilie Rose LANG married Leopold Louis Dreyfus, and had children including Charles Louis Dreyfus. Emilie Rose LANG passed away in 1918 in Paris, 75008.
